CTA Reroutes #55 Garfield Buses on South Side

Westbound #55 Garfield buses are taking a detour through Hyde Park due to a street blockage near 55th Street and Lake Park Avenue, the Chicago Transit Authority said Monday night. The temporary reroute affects only westbound service, with buses traveling via 55th Street, Lake Park Avenue, 51st Street, and Cottage Grove Avenue before returning to the regular route. Eastbound buses aren't affected and continue operating normally.

Street Blockage Prompts Service Adjustment

The CTA issued the customer alert at 10:02 PM on April 13, 2026, in response to the street obstruction. Transit agencies typically implement temporary reroutes when construction, emergencies, or other incidents block regular bus paths. The modification ensures continued service to the corridor while crews address the blockage. Officials said the change affects a key South Side route that connects Hyde Park, Kenwood, and Garfield Park neighborhoods, though specific ridership numbers for the route weren't immediately available.

Detour Path Adds Several Blocks to Route

Westbound buses now travel south on Lake Park Avenue to 51st Street, then west on 51st to Cottage Grove Avenue, before heading north back to 55th Street to resume normal routing. The detour adds approximately four blocks to the journey in each direction affected. Transit officials said the reroute is expected to cause minor delays for westbound passengers and advised riders to allow extra travel time. The agency hasn't specified how much additional time riders should budget for trips on the affected segment.

Duration of Reroute Remains Unclear

The CTA listed the duration of the temporary reroute as to be determined, with no timeline provided for when normal service will resume. Officials haven't said what caused the street blockage or how long repairs or clearance work might take. The agency typically updates service alerts as situations develop, but a schedule for providing additional information wasn't available. Transit officials said they'll notify riders when buses return to regular routing on 55th Street.
